From mboxrd@z Thu Jan 1 00:00:00 1970 From: Steven Whitehouse Date: Wed, 09 Mar 2011 11:38:13 +0000 Subject: [Cluster-devel] GFS2: Remove potential race in flock code Message-ID: <1299670693.2587.12.camel@dolmen> List-Id: To: cluster-devel.redhat.com MIME-Version: 1.0 Content-Type: text/plain; charset="us-ascii" Content-Transfer-Encoding: 7bit This patch ensures that we always wait for glock demotion when dropping flocks on a file in order to prevent any race conditions associated with further flock calls or closing the file. Signed-off-by: Steven Whitehouse diff --git a/fs/gfs2/file.c b/fs/gfs2/file.c index 216ad27..2878481 100644 --- a/fs/gfs2/file.c +++ b/fs/gfs2/file.c @@ -981,8 +981,10 @@ static void do_unflock(struct file *file, struct file_lock *fl) mutex_lock(&fp->f_fl_mutex); flock_lock_file_wait(file, fl); - if (fl_gh->gh_gl) - gfs2_glock_dq_uninit(fl_gh); + if (fl_gh->gh_gl) { + gfs2_glock_dq_wait(fl_gh); + gfs2_holder_uninit(fl_gh); + } mutex_unlock(&fp->f_fl_mutex); }
